#968491 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#968491 is composed of 58.8% red, 51.8%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12% magenta, 3.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 316.7 degrees, a saturation of 7.9% and a lightness of 55.3%. #968491 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2d0923.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#968491

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040304 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#968491

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d8d is the less saturated color, while #f624bc is the most saturated one.
